Intel Core i3-3210 cpu@3.20GHz 3.2GHz
Ram: 4GB
System Type: 64-bit
Broken: v2.80, 2019-03-15,
Worked: v2.79b
Double clicking blender.exe to install initiates cmd window and a blink of gray window with nothing on it then it just quits.
After checking what others were doing, tried to run it from terminal(cmd) with --debug-gpu and the cmd window showed a bunch of text and number that I don't understand.

Closing due to lack of information to further investigate the issue, we can reopen the report if more information is provided.
Note that installing dll files from websites like dll4free.com is generally a bad idea and can often do more harm than good. Graphics drivers should be installed from the Intel website.
